Understanding the biology of these pests is the first step in efficient management. Subterranean species are the main issue in New South Wales as they take a trip through the soil and develop detailed mud tunnels to access timber inside structures. They look for moisture and cellulose typically entering through tiny cracks in the concrete piece or through weep holes in brickwork. Because these pests work quietly and out of sight they can consume the internal structure of a home for many years without being found by the naked eye.

After confirming the existence of termites or assessing the danger, different treatment options are checked out. A common technique involves establishing a chemical border around the structure by digging a trench around the structure and applying a specialized termiticide to the surrounding soil. The objective is to develop a barrier of cured soil that either discourages termites or eliminates them upon contact. Contemporary non-repellent termiticides are particularly effective, as they are undetectable to the pests, permitting them to unknowingly cross the cured area and transportation the substance back to their nest, ultimately annihilating the entire colony through a process of indirect transfer.
For homes in Jerrabomberra, termite treatment can also involve the setup of baiting and monitoring systems. This method is especially beneficial when conventional soil barrier methods are unwise due to barriers like paving or elaborate garden styles. Tactically placed around the home, bait stations bring in termites that are out foraging for food. Inside these stations, specifically treated wood or cellulose baits containing a growth inhibitor are used to draw the termites. As soon as the termites consume the bait, they transfer it to their colony, hindering the insects' capability to molt and ultimately triggering read more the colony's death. This baiting approach provides a reputable, long-term solution, as it not only removes the termite problem but also enables regular inspections to verify the property remains termite-free.
Prevention is equally essential as the treatment itself. Homeowners in the city can take several steps to decrease the beauty of their residential or commercial property to these pests. Guaranteeing that garden beds are avoided the edge of your house is vital as mulch and soil stacked against the walls supply a surprise bridge for entry. Fixing leaking taps or faulty downpipes is also important because excess wetness in the soil produces a beacon for foraging nests. Moreover storing fire wood or scrap timber far from the main structure and ensuring that subfloor areas are well ventilated can substantially reduce the threat of an invasion. It is a common mistaken belief that brick and steel framed homes are unsusceptible to damage. While the main frame might be resistant these pests can still find their method into timber floor covering or window frames and cabinetry.
